How do you decompose a fraction into a unit fraction?
To decompose a fraction simply means to take it apart. The most basic way to decompose a fraction is to break into unit fractions, which is when the numerator (top number) is 1. We can see that 5/8 is the same as the unit fraction 1/8 five times.
What does decompose a fraction mean?
To decompose a fraction means dividing a fraction into smaller fractions, such that on adding all the smaller parts together, it results in the initial fraction.

How do you decompose equations?
A decomposition reaction occurs when one reactant breaks down into two or more products. It can be represented by the general equation: AB → A + B. In this equation, AB represents the reactant that begins the reaction, and A and B represent the products of the reaction.
What are the three types of decomposition reactions?
Decomposition reactions can be classified into three types:
- Thermal decomposition reaction.
- Electrolytic decomposition reaction.
- Photo decomposition reaction.

How do you balance equations with charges?
Balance charge. Add e- (electrons) to one side of each half-reaction to balance charge. You may need to multiply the electrons by the two half-reactions to get the charge to balance out. It’s fine to change coefficients as long as you change them on both sides of the equation.
What is an unbalanced equation?
If the number of atoms of each element in reactants is not equal to the number of atoms of each element present in product, then the chemical equation is called unbalanced chemical equation.
How do you balance odd numbers in a chemical equation?
Rule 4: Balancing chemical equations using the even/odd technique. If you have an even number of a certain element on one side of the equation and an odd number of the same element on the other side of the equation, multiply both sides of the equation through by the coefficient of 2.
When balancing equations do you add or multiply?
When ever you balance reactions, it is always important to remember two important things. First, never change the subscripts, only change the coefficients and second, always multiply the coefficient by the subscript to determine how many of each element are in the reaction.
What are the 5 basic types of reactions?
The five basic types of chemical reactions are combination, decomposition, single-replacement, double-replacement, and combustion. Analyzing the reactants and products of a given reaction will allow you to place it into one of these categories. Some reactions will fit into more than one category.
What is the goal of balancing a chemical equation?
A balanced equation obeys the Law of Conservation of Mass. This is an important guiding principal in science. Finally, a balanced equation lets up predict the amount of reactants needed and the amount of products formed.
